David Butt Close, Stonehouse house prices

In David Butt Close, Stonehouse, the median price a home actually changed hands for is £349,000. Over the past decade prices are +21% in cash — but −2% once inflation is stripped out.

David Butt Close, Stonehouse house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in David Butt Close, Stonehouse?

Half of homes sold in David Butt Close, Stonehouse went for more than £349,000 and half for less, across 23 sales.

What is the price range of homes sold in David Butt Close, Stonehouse?

Recorded sales in David Butt Close, Stonehouse range from £290,000 to £535,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in David Butt Close, Stonehouse risen?

Over the past decade prices in David Butt Close, Stonehouse are +21% in cash terms but −2%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in David Butt Close, Stonehouse?

In David Butt Close, Stonehouse the median price is £3,409 per square metre, from 17 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in David Butt Close, Stonehouse was 15 December 2025.
